找不到顺手的Python库?不知道如何使用?教你2步得到答案

https://m.toutiao.com/is/JnyXMvK/

很多新手,对python很茫然,不知道python有哪些包,都做什么用的?应该怎么学习?

对于这些问题,我们今天分两步告诉大家。

1、我们都有哪些包?

这个问题,很难回答,其实python的包非常非常多,多到什么程度,可以认为你能看到的所有的编程行为背后(除了一些系统级的)都有一个对应的python包。

这里介绍3个地方可以查找。

(1)python 标准库文档

搜索python标准库,你就可以找到链接,并获取名称。

(2)你电脑里装了哪些包?

在pycharmIDE的setting里可以查到你目前安装了哪些包

(3)PyPI

这个网站可以查询非常多的你想要的python第三方开发包。搜索pypi可以找到地址。

然后你就可以查找你要的包了,如果不知道?你可以查“我想做什么,python有什么包推荐”获取。当然你时间足够,可以在pypi里一个一个的查找。

2、知道了包之后如何寻求使用帮助

当然,如果是 第三方库,通常会有教程,如果没有,只有通过文档来查看。这就是为什么我们自己在写程序的时候希望大家能写注释和文档的原因。

例如,我想知道math这个库,有什么用。我们可以在终端输入,import math,然后help(math)

会有详细的介绍。大家要学者使用help。

当然,我们还可以通过IDE来学习,例如

输入.之后,也会列出相关的内容。

3、结论

Python的包非常强大,文档也非常健全。但是如果你不知道怎么找就很尴尬了。

Python是一个开源的社群语言,被全世界的人接受,能普遍到这个地步大家应该能明白他强大之处。要知道,那些商业软件都要俯首称臣的。

大家对python的包的疑问可以在下方留言评论。

祝大家学习愉快。

(0)

相关推荐

  • 这10个奇妙的Python库,你必须要试试

    大家好,我是小F- Python有着很多很酷的第三方库,可以使任务变得更容易. 今天就给大家分享10个有趣的Python库,每个都非常实用! 分别是speedtest.socket.textblob. ...

  • Python|天天向上的力量

    引言今天我们要来解决学习问题呢,这次我们要学习python中最常见的math,math库中有很多函数,我们只需要掌握最常用的就可以了.math库中的函数没法直接使用,首先使用保留字import引用该库 ...

  • pytest文档56-插件打包上传到 pypi 库

    前言 pytest 的插件完成之后,可以上传到 github,方便其他小伙伴通过 pip 源码安装.如果我们想通过 pip install packages 这种方式安装的话,需上传到 pypi 仓库 ...

  • Python|处理word的基本操作

    问题描述 众所周知python有很多第三方库,这也是python简单实用的原因.要想用python处理word文档就需要安装python-docx库. 解决方案 1.安装python-docx库 首先 ...

  • 发布代码到 PyPI

    来源:Python 技术「ID: pythonall」 写 Python 程序的童鞋们都知道安装模块使用 pip install xxxx 命令,那么知道怎样将自己的代码发布到 PyPI 让全世界 P ...

  • 80%的人都不知道,全球Python库下载前10名

    原创 菜鸟哥 菜鸟学Python 2020-04-03 题图:漫威宇宙英雄 Python的简洁性,不仅仅在于其语法简单,还有各种python库函数的支持,为大家节省了大量的时间和精力,所以网上有人戏称 ...

  • 想找外包公司托管网站,但是不知道网站托管包括什么?

    全网天下,一站式网络营销服务商 一般企业在进行网络营销都是缺少不了网站.网站是一个企业的基础也是核心,许多人查看了解企业,首先都要在其官网上看看.给客户一个直观了解,企业如何能没有网站维护人员. 这种 ...

  • 简直让人欲罢不能!820个ML Python库,star超260万,持续周更中...

    深度学习技术前沿 120篇原创内容 公众号 当你发愁找不到合适的开源项目时,有人已经悄悄地整理好了.今天要介绍的这个 GitHub 项目提供了大量机器学习 Python 库,覆盖机器学习框架.数据可视 ...

  • 终于把所有的Python库,都整理出来啦!

    Python爱好者社区 1周前 来源:法纳斯特 大家好,我是小五

  • Python库大全,建议收藏留用!

    学Python,想必大家都是从爬虫开始的吧.毕竟网上类似的资源很丰富,开源项目也非常多. Python学习网络爬虫主要分3个大的版块:抓取,分析,存储 当我们在浏览器中输入一个url后回车,后台会发生 ...

  • 15个好用到哭的python库,真不错!

    为什么很多人喜欢Python?对于初学者来说,这是一种简单易学的编程语言,另一个原因:大量开箱即用的第三方库,正是23万个由用户提供的软件包使得Python真正强大和流行. 在本文中,我挑选了15个最 ...

  • 10大Python库介绍!

    现在转行学编程,很多人都会选择Python,很大一部分原因是因为Python具有丰富的第三方库,既可以帮助我们提高开发效率,还能够缩减代码量.那么你知道Python有哪些库吗?这里为大家介绍10个,总 ...

  • 终于把所有的 Python 库都整理出来啦

    来源丨法纳 常用库 Chardet字符编码探测器,可以自动检测文本.网页.xml的编码. colorama主要用来给文本添加各种颜色,并且非常简单易用. Prettytable主要用于在终端或浏览器端 ...

  • 谁是2020年最强Python库?年度Top10出炉

    蕾师师 发自 凹非寺 量子位 报道 | 公众号 QbitAI 2020年已经过去了,国外的一家专门提供Python服务的网站Troy Labs,盘点出了2020年发布的Python库Top10. 上榜 ...